Stainless steel from China to Ukraine
304, 316 and architectural-grade stainless sheet, coil and pipe sourced in China and delivered into Ukraine — grade-verified by PMI testing against the mill certificate, with customs handled end to end.
Stainless steel is where grade fraud is most common out of China: 201 or low-nickel material sold as 304, or 304 passed off as 316. For Ukrainian buyers in food processing, water and chemical infrastructure, or architecture, the wrong grade corrodes in service — and the price gap is exactly what tempts a trader to substitute. This page covers the China-to-Ukraine route for stainless steel.
We confirm the producer, verify the mill test certificate, and — the part that matters for stainless — run positive material identification (PMI) to confirm the actual alloy before shipment, so 304 is 304 and 316 is 316. Getting it from China to Ukraine
Two working corridors, chosen per cargo, value and the current security picture.
EU land corridor (primary)
By sea or rail to Constanța (Romania), Gdańsk/Gdynia (Poland) or Klaipėda (Lithuania), then road or rail into Ukraine. Typically ~20–30 days door-to-door, and the more predictable option.
Black Sea corridor (direct)
Direct to Pivdennyi, Chornomorsk or Odesa via Ukraine's sea corridor. Roughly ~45–60 days from China depending on Suez vs. Cape routing, and subject to the current security situation.
Transit times are typical ranges, not guarantees — we confirm the corridor, port and schedule for each shipment before you commit.
Duty, VAT & customs into Ukraine
Stainless steel enters Ukraine at the standard import rates: a low most-favoured-nation duty (the exact line follows the HS 7219/7220 sub-code for sheet, coil or pipe) plus 20% import VAT on the customs value. There is no wartime exemption for stainless, so duty and VAT are part of the landed cost from the start.
We prepare the export and customs documentation — including the mill certificate and PMI report — and clear through the Single Window, so the grade, classification and traceability are settled before the goods move.

Frequently asked questions
How do you stop 201 being sold as 304 or 316?
We run positive material identification (PMI / spectrometer) on the actual goods before shipment and cross-check against the mill certificate and heat number — so the alloy you pay for is the alloy you receive. Grade fraud is the single biggest risk in stainless out of China.
What duty and VAT apply to stainless steel in Ukraine?
A low MFN customs duty (exact by HS 7219/7220 sub-code) plus 20% import VAT on the customs value. Stainless has no wartime exemption, so both are planned into the landed cost up front.
Can you supply food-contact or architectural grades?
Yes — 304/304L for food and general use, 316/316L for chemical and marine corrosion resistance, plus finishes (2B, BA, mirror, brushed) for architecture. We confirm grade and finish with the producer and verify both before shipment.
How does it reach Ukraine and how long?
Via the EU land corridor (Constanța, Gdańsk or Klaipėda then road/rail), typically ~20–30 days door-to-door, or direct Black Sea (~45–60 days, security-dependent).
